LEVEL 1, Men's 80+ Singles Final. Parker (1) vs Dollins (3)

  • Jimmy Parker is currently ranked No. 1 in his age group in the USA and is a computer-ranked 4.5 player. These guys are seriously vying for a Gold Ball in the finals of a Level 1 tournament. Dollins, ranked lower, comes out ahead in this grueling match.
